E11-1Â Â Â Â Â Depreciation Methods The Gruman Company purchased a machine for $220,000 on January 2, 2004. It made the following estimates:
Service life                                                        5 years or 10,000  hours
Production                                                      200,000 units
Residual value                                                   $20,000
In 2007, the company uses the machine for 1,800 hours and produces 44,000 units.
Compute the depreciation for 2007 under each of the following methods:
1.     Straight-line
2.     Hours worked
3.     Units of output
